Actors who almost gave up before becoming famous

Michael Michael, May 8, 2026May 8, 2026

Most breakout roles look sudden from the outside. One movie, one TV show, one audition, and suddenly an actor becomes famous.

But behind many of those “overnight success” stories are years of rejection, unpaid bills, bad auditions, side jobs, and moments where quitting felt like the smarter choice.

Some actors were days away from leaving Los Angeles. Some planned to return home. Some had already started thinking about other careers. Others were simply exhausted from hearing “no” again and again.

Here are actors who nearly quit before the role that changed their careers.

1. John Krasinski

Source : Wikipedia

Before The Office, John Krasinski was close to giving up on acting.

He had moved to New York to pursue his career, but after years of rejection, he told his mother he wanted to quit. She reportedly encouraged him to wait a little longer. Soon after, he landed the role of Jim Halpert on The Office.

That one role turned him from a struggling actor into one of TV’s most beloved comedy stars.

20. Meryl Streep

Source : Wikipedia

Meryl Streep was already a legend, but she was ready to retire before The Devil Wears Prada.

In a recent interview, Streep said she was considering retirement before taking the role of Miranda Priestly. She initially declined the offer, then doubled her salary request, and the studio accepted. PEOPLE reported that Streep was “ready to retire” before the 2006 film.

The role became one of her most quoted and widely loved performances, adding a new pop-culture chapter to an already historic career.

21. Eric Braeden

Source : Instagram/ericbraedengudegast

Eric Braeden nearly quit The Young and the Restless after only one year.

He found the pace of daytime television overwhelming and was frustrated with playing what felt like another villain role. PEOPLE reported that co-creator William J. Bell gave Victor Newman deeper backstory, which helped convince Braeden to stay.

That decision mattered: Victor Newman became one of daytime TV’s most famous characters.

22. Eva Longoria

Source : Instagram/evalongoria

Eva Longoria balanced acting with a regular job before her breakout.

Before Desperate Housewives, she worked as a headhunter while trying to make it in Hollywood. PEOPLE reported that she continued that work even during her early acting years until her career became more stable.

Her role as Gabrielle Solis on Desperate Housewives turned her into a household name.
